Parnassus Fixed Income Fund - Investor Shares (PRFIX) is focused on providing investors with a diversified portfolio of fixed income securities, primarily targeting investment-grade bonds. The fund's competitive position is bolstered by its commitment to socially responsible investing, which attracts a niche segment of investors seeking both yield and ethical considerations.
The fund generates revenue primarily through management fees based on the assets under management (AUM). Its competitive advantage lies in its focus on socially responsible investing, which differentiates it from traditional fixed income funds and attracts a dedicated investor base willing to pay for ethical considerations.
